Modular Sectionals

You know the struggle of hosting a party and realizing half your guests have nowhere to sit.
A modular sectional solves this problem by letting you play furniture Tetris whenever the mood strikes.
The 2026 design trends favor powder coated aluminum frames because they do not rust when the sky decides to open up.
You should look for quick dry cushions to avoid that damp jeans feeling after a light rain.
Swap your layout into a long line for movie nights or create a curved configuration for close conversation.

Curved Lounge Chairs

Sharp corners are fine for math class but your body prefers soft arcs and organic shapes.
These curved lounge chairs embrace a mid century modern vibe while providing much better lumbar support than your old folding chairs.
You will find that these shapes encourage a natural flow of movement across your deck.
Use weather resistant wicker or metal versions with plush upholstery to ensure they survive the seasons.
Placing them near a view or a fire pit creates an instant relaxation zone.
Wicker Conversation Sets

Wicker has officially graduated from your grandmother’s dusty sunroom into a high tech outdoor staple.
Modern synthetic materials now mimic honeyed wood tones without the annoying habit of snapping or fading under intense UV rays.
You can arrange an intricately woven sofa and matching loveseat to create an intimate hub for morning coffee.
These sets provide a textured look that bridges the gap between your indoor comfort and the great outdoors.
Simply hose them down once in a while to keep them looking fresh.

Concrete Coffee Tables

If you want a table that will not blow away during a stiff breeze, concrete is your best friend.
These sculptural, free form pieces add a heavy, modern aesthetic to a soft seating area.
You might choose a matte finish to contrast with glossy planters or vibrant textiles.
Many manufacturers now offer eco friendly composites that look like natural stone but weigh slightly less.
Nesting options allow you to expand your surface area when those extra snack trays come out of the kitchen.
Fire Pit Seating Circles

Humans have huddled around fire for ages and your backyard should be no exception.
You can position a set of classic Adirondack chairs or low profile sectionals around a portable fire pit to create a natural gathering spot.
Use heat resistant materials like metal or stone for the furniture legs to ensure safety.
Adding extra layers of cushions and blankets will extend your patio season well into the cooler autumn months.
This layout keeps the conversation moving as everyone faces the warmth.

Sustainable Teak Dining Sets

Teak remains the gold standard for outdoor wood because its natural oils fight off rot and pests with ease.
You can invest in an FSC certified set to ensure your furniture comes from responsibly managed forests.
Extendable tables work brilliantly for hosting large al fresco meals without cluttering your patio every day.
Pair your table with performance fabric chairs for a blend of comfort and durability.
A simple maintenance routine keeps the wood looking warm and prevents silvering.
